WHY SOFTWARE CHORUS SOUNDS FLAT

Most digital chorus is a delay line and a sine wave, and that is exactly what it sounds like. The hardware everyone remembers was a signal path with opinions. OLFACTORY models the whole path, not the delay line.

  • · A true 2:1 compander wrapped around every bucket line, with the expander tracking the delayed signal — so the noise floor breathes with your playing, exactly like the original chips.
  • · Band-limited wet voices — pre-emphasis in, mirrored de-emphasis out, and a reconstruction ceiling that darkens as you push CHARACTER. The lushness sits behind the dry signal, where it belongs.
  • · Imperfect LFOs — triangle cores smoothed by the same RC constant as the classic pedal circuit, trapezoids for the dimension-style voicings, a pure sinusoid for the ADM engine.
  • · Voice asymmetry and drift — every voice carries its own delay offset, its own slightly detuned filters, and a share of one slow correlated random walk: the "alive" quality of aged hardware warming up.
VOICING — Nine Voicings, Five Circuits, Zero Guesswork

The classics were not knob machines — they were voicings. OLFACTORY ships as a nine-cell grid, each cell a hardware-derived geometry: voice count, delay times, LFO shape and stereo behaviour taken from the real circuits.

  • · JUNO I / JUNO II — the polysynth ensemble: short bucket lines, slow rounded triangles, instant string-machine bloom.
  • · CE — the pedal that defined chorus for guitar: one voice, a wide 5–25 ms sweep, warm mids, gentle top. Push MIX to 100% and it becomes true vibrato, just like holding the pedal's switch.
  • · DIM 1–4 — the studio dimension trick: two voices modulated in exact opposition so the average delay never moves. Depth without wobble; the effect you feel more than hear.
  • · TRI — the triple-chorus rack behind two decades of session guitar: three voices, three LFOs spaced 120° apart, spread left-centre-right.
  • · RATE and DEPTH are trims, not global controls pretending every circuit is the same. DEPTH at 50% is the hardware value. Tempo-sync is everywhere, with dotted and triplet divisions.
ADM — A Different Machine, Same Knobs

One early-80s rack delay keeps showing up in "best modulation ever" threads, and it never sounded like anything else because it never worked like anything else: instead of PCM, it encoded audio as a one-bit adaptive delta-modulation stream.

  • · Slope-overload rounding — transients arrive rounded because fast edges outrun the adapting step size, with the codec's syllabic 60 ms decay.
  • · Breathing grain — a fine grain underneath, correlated with your playing.
  • · Shared-clock sweep — modulation rides the same continuous clock as the delay itself, so the sweep is pure liquid: no stepping, just glide.
  • · It is not a filter pretending to be old. It is the mechanism.
SILLAGE — Width That Survives the Club

Here is the category's dirty secret: many "stereo" choruses get their width from phase-inverted copies. Sum them to mono and the width does not shrink — it vanishes. No plugin has ever offered a safeguard. OLFACTORY ships one.

  • · Width is built from voice placement, never polarity — constant-power panning and delay decorrelation, the same mechanism that made the triple-chorus rack mono-safe by construction in 1987.
  • · A correlation governor — with MONO SAFE engaged, OLFACTORY continuously measures the correlation of its actual output. Below the safety floor the governor smoothly reins the width in (attack in milliseconds, release in half a second) and a GOVERNOR lamp lights while it works. A limiter, acting on decorrelation instead of level.
  • · Live proof — a correlation meter with the floor marked on it, and a mono-sum meter showing in dB exactly what a mono fold-down costs you. Measured from the output, not modelled.
  • · Widen until the lamp flickers. That is the edge: maximum width that provably survives the sum.
CHARACTER, DRIFT & THE SCOPE

Two knobs carry the aging, and the scope proves it. Both at zero is still a vintage-voiced instrument; both up is a machine with a history.

  • · CHARACTER — how much of the medium you get: clock noise rising out of the floor, the wet path darkening toward its vintage ceiling, the input stage thickening. On the ADM engine, the codec rounds harder and the grain breathes louder.
  • · DRIFT — the slow, correlated wander of voices that have been powered on all afternoon.
  • · See what you hear — the scope draws the actual per-voice delay motion the engine is running, not an animation. Watch the dimension voicings mirror each other in perfect opposition, the triple-chorus voices chase each other 120° apart, and DRIFT roughen the lines in real time.
